This repository contains some of the supporting applications based on Bsig and H5 parsers.
- Run the file bsig_sig_val_publish.py file to start off the eCAL based application.
- The subscriber and publisher topic names are defined in the constructor of the class.
- The messages are transmitted over eCAL through protobuf.
- The message structure is defined in Radar.proto
- Compile the proto file using the command protoc -I=.\ --python_out=.\ Radar.proto
- Bsig_app/publish_signals_bsig.py has the sample code to publish data to produce data from bsig files
- The path of the bsig file, signal names list, object id count(number of objects) is published over a common topic.
- The bsig_sig_val_publish.py will publish all the related data for common and object signals over eCAL.
Note: Bsig_app/bsig_optimize/init.py has the sample code to read data for multiple signals from a bsig file
- Run the file H5_app/hfl_image_generator/h5_image_publisher.py
- It is a generic application to publish images to Label tool 5G.
- Run the file H5_app/hfl_image_generator/h5_image_publisher.py file to start off the eCAL based application.
- Label tool publishes input message under the topic name 'channel_request' defined in topics.json
- Ask for channel data(True).
- It will read H5 file, fetches number of devices, channels and timestamps mapped to their channels.
- Device, channel and respective time stamps is published under the topic name 'channel_response' defined in topics.json
- Run H5_app/hfl_image_generator/hfl_test_device.py It has the sample code to publish data requesting H5 file to send the values.
- Once user has channel and timestamp data, one could request image based on these parameters.
- Publish device, channel and timestamp under the topic name 'hfl_request' defined in topics.json
- The callback function would send the image as an encoded string under the topic name 'hfl_response' defined in topics.json
